The Pic18f27J53 has the following features:
Program Memory Type | Flash |
Program Memory (KB) | 128 |
CPU Speed (MIPS) | 12 |
RAM Bytes | 3800 |
Digital Communication Peripherals | 2-A/E/USART, 2-MSSP(SPI/I2C) |
Capture/Compare/PWM Peripherals | 7 CCP, 3 ECCP |
Timers | 4 x 8-bit, 4 x 16-bit |
ADC 10 ch, 12-bit | |
Comparators | 3 |
USB (ch, speed, compliance) | 1, Full Speed, USB 2.0 |
Temperature Range (C) | -40 to 85 |
Operating Voltage Range (V) | 2 to 3.6 |
Pin Count | 28 |
XLP | Yes |
Cap Touch Channels | 10 |
Now I’ve designed a little board that could be fit into a breadboard for fast prototype.
This board fits in the exact form factor of DIL600 28 pin with full pin-out compatibility.
The Board is the evolution of the PICCOLETTA board . I developed this board to fit the pic18f2550, and to learn how to use the USB interface. The PICCOLETTA PCB was modified to support the 3,3 volt pic (27j53, 26J53 …. ) using a 3,3 volt LDO Voltage regulator ( the mcp1700) , and I also provide the possibility to mount an electronic component for EMI filter and ESD protection. Actually I haven’t it and I replace with some resistors.
Characteristics:
- Power supply can be selected, useing a jumper) between the USB port or an external board.
- Power distribution from the USB port (5V) to the external board (150 ma MAX)
- The oscillator can be excluded using a solder pad.
- On board led can be used as power supply led or as test ping. The configuration has to be done using a solder pad.
Use
Enclosed into a dongle box it can be used for:
- Security Key
- Dongle Key
- Security access (using the key as a rolling code)
- Personal identification
Out from the dongle box
- USB to RS232/TTL
- USB to I2C
- USB to SPI
- TCP/UDP server (with an enc28j60)
- Programmable I/O
- LCD Controller Interface
- RELAY I/O
- MOTOR Controller
Finally it can be used as a developer Board.
The ICSP programming connector is present, it is compatible with pic-kit2 and 3/3. A solder pad is present on the connector to exclude PIN-6.
Fisical Dimension:
- Length : 61,3 mm
- Width : 18,2 mm
- Height : 10,4 mm
Piccoletta2 can be programmed trough the USB.

The BOM
Component | Value | Type |
C1 | 220n | Metallized PE Film Capacitor C025-024X044 |
C2, C6, C7 | 0,1uF | Metallized PE Film Capacitor C025-024X044 |
C3, C8 | 10uF 18V | Tantalium Capacitor Electrolitic Radial (5x11x2,5) |
C4, C5 | 18pf | Metallized PE Film Capacitor C050-024X044 |
R2, R5 | 10K 1% | Metal film resistor (0204) 0,4 Watt |
R3 | 3,3K 1% | Metal film resistor (0204) 0,4 Watt |
R1, R4 | 10 Ohm 1% | Metal film resistor (0204) 0,4 Watt |
R7, R8 | 22 Ohm 1% | Resistor MINI_MELF-0204R (1206) 0,4 Watt |
IC1 | PIC18F27J53_28DIP | MIL 300 DIP28 |
IC2 | MCP1700 | TO93 |
Microchip LDO regulator 250mA | ||
IC3 | IP4220CZ6 | SOT457R_PHILIPS |
It’s used for EMI filter and ESD protection | ||
ACTUALLY I HAVEN’T IT and UNUSED | ||
L1 | Led 3mm red | 15 mcd 40° The power led |
ICSP | 6 pin header | ICSP PIC programming connector pin |
Pin 1 Vpp « MCLR pin pic | ||
Pin 2 Vcc « | ||
Pin 3 Gnd « | ||
Pin 4 PGD « PGD pin pic | ||
Pin 5 PGC « PGC pin pic | ||
Pin 6 PGM « PGM pin pic (could be unused) | ||
T | 1 pin header | Test pin led. (active low) |
R | 1 pin header | Button for bootloader selection. Actually it is not present in the board |
JP2 | 2×3 pin header | Power selection see |
S1 | 2 solder pad | Used to select the power supply |
S2, S3 | 2 solder pad | Used to select the oscillator S2, S3 « closed (factory setting) select the on board oscillator. |
S2, S3 « open for future expansion | ||
S4 | 2 solder pad | S4 « close (if the pic has the PGM pin) |
S4 « open disconnect the PGM pin | ||
Q1 | Oscillator 12Mhz | HC49U-V |
USB connector | USB-A-H |
